Myth: Granite Countertops Are Prone to Cracking and Chipping Easily

One of the most prevalent myths is that granite countertops are easily damaged by everyday use, leading to cracks and chips.

Reality: Granite is one of the most durable natural stones available, ranking 6 to 7 on the Mohs scale of hardness. This level of hardness makes granite highly resistant to cracks and chips under normal kitchen conditions. Granite countertops can withstand the rigors of daily kitchen activities, including chopping, cutting, and even placing hot pots directly on the surface without damage. Myth: Granite Countertops Are High-Maintenance

Another common belief is that granite countertops require constant and intensive maintenance to keep them looking their best.

Reality: Granite countertops are surprisingly low-maintenance. The key to maintaining granite is ensuring it is properly sealed, which prevents staining and makes the surface easy to clean. Modern sealants can last for several years, reducing the need for frequent reapplications. Routine cleaning with a mild detergent and water is typically all that’s needed to keep granite looking pristine. Myth: Granite Countertops Are Not Heat-Resistant

A common misconception is that granite countertops cannot withstand high temperatures and are prone to damage from hot pots and pans.

Reality: Granite is formed under extreme heat and pressure within the Earth, making it one of the most heat-resistant materials available for countertops. You can place hot pots and pans directly on a granite surface without worrying about damage, although it’s still advisable to use trivets or hot pads to preserve the sealant and ensure the longevity of your countertops. Myth: Granite Countertops Emit Harmful Radiation

Some people believe that granite countertops emit dangerous levels of radiation, making them unsafe for use in the home.

Reality: While it’s true that granite, like many natural materials, contains trace amounts of radioactive elements, the levels are extremely low and pose no significant health risk. Numerous studies and tests have shown that the amount of radiation emitted by granite countertops is well within the safety limits established by global health organizations.
